So, here's a breakdown of what's been in the stream so far:

-The A180 is multi-mode. You lose your Star Cards for those modes: sniper, rifle and ion. Actually kind of reminds me of Republic Commando.
-DT-29 - Revolver with six shots. You have to manually reload it, it has no overheat.
-TIE Striker: Strafing run sort of thing.
-U-Wing: Pilotable in Infiltration Phase 1 (random selection as to who gets to play in one, like the 'assigning pilots' in the Death Star DLC Battle Station mode). In Phase 2, the U-Wing is like the AT-AT: you only get a couple of minutes in it and can't control it outright, instead firing from a minigun with splash damage from the side.
-AT-ACT: Only appears in the Battle Beyond.
-Infiltration: Act 1 - escort the U-Wings to the gate. Act 2: blow up a cargo ship. Act 3: steal the datatapes.
-Armour: heroes can give or reduce armour which alters the damage you take. Krennic's ability is a debuff.
-No Ben Ben Mendelsohn or Felicity Jones for the voices.
-Infiltration, Blast, Turning Point, Walker Assault and Fighter Squadron are the modes, across a total of four maps.
-As expected, there is no seamless ground-to-space.
-Rank is being increased to 100. Two Imperial skins confirmed: Shoretrooper and Shoretrooper Commander.
-Walker Assault only has two phases instead of the customary 3, but there are still 2 AT-ATs. No AT-ACTs.
-No new skirmish content for the rest of the game's lifespan.
